Just wanted to share with everyone some great work that Hamza did with my RC-F! Very happy with the results - water and dirt just bead and run off the paint / wind shield.
What was done?
- Full decontamination
- Polish
- CQuartz UK on:
- Paint
- Trim
- Rims
- Glass and non-porous surfaces

How long did it take?
- 24 hours + 10 hours or so for curing (although 24 hours is recommended for curing - basically leaving it parked with no water on the paint)
How much does it cost to get this done?
- I will PM you
Can you see or feel any difference because of the CQuartz layer being added?
- i see the raindrops on the hood beading and floating away
Will it have to be re-applied at some point?
- Hamza says in about siz or so months he can do a touch up for me, but its meant to least 2 years.
